November travel from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ta International Airport (ATL) to O'Hare International Airport (ORD) blends autumn shoulder-season savings with a Thanksgiving spike in demand. Early November often offers lower fares and more flight availability, while the week before Thanksgiving sees premium pricing and fuller flights. Use price alerts and flexible-date searches to capture discounts; midweek departures (Tuesday–Wednesday) usually have the best deals. For ground logistics, rely on MARTA for downtown access or reserve parking in advance if leaving a car. Remember that Chicago's cooler November weather can cause inbound delays, so allow buffer time when connecting. November arrivals at O'Hare International Airport (ORD) coming from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ta International Airport (ATL) should prepare for cooler weather, potential precipitation, and heavier loads during Thanksgiving travel. The CTA Blue Line provides direct rail service to downtown Chicago, while regional Metra/Pace, shuttles, and ride-shares connect riders to suburbs like Evanston, Naperville, and nearby cities such as Milwaukee and Rockford. For smoother travel, monitor flight status, pack warm layers, and consider pre-booking shuttles or car services during holiday weekends. ORD's terminal amenities remain open in November, and travelers can find restaurants and shops to wait out delays.
